Kiyoko Oi Featured in Beppu-Oita Mainichi Marathon Memorial Program

In February 1979, Kiyoko Oi ran the Beppu-Oita Mainichi Marathon with fellow Ondekoza members and became the first Japanese woman to complete a marathon, thus establishing the first record time in Japan for a female marathon runner of 2 hours, 48 minutes, 52 seconds. This marathon will hold its 60th run in 2011, and will be introduced on the TV program Betsudai Densetsu.
